The Turkmenistan Robotic Pool Cleaner market is experiencing steady growth due to increasing demand for efficient and convenient pool maintenance solutions. With the country`s growing focus on tourism and leisure activities, there has been a rise in the number of residential and commercial pools, driving the need for automated cleaning technologies. Robotic pool cleaners are becoming increasingly popular in Turkmenistan due to their advanced features such as programmable cleaning schedules, energy efficiency, and superior debris removal capabilities. Market players are introducing innovative products tailored to the specific needs of Turkmenistan consumers, such as models designed for larger pool sizes and varying pool shapes. The market is expected to witness further expansion as consumers seek time-saving and cost-effective pool cleaning solutions.

In the Turkmenistan Robotic Pool Cleaner market, some challenges include limited consumer awareness and education about the benefits and advantages of robotic pool cleaners compared to traditional methods. The market may also face obstacles in terms of affordability and price sensitivity among consumers, as robotic pool cleaners are typically more expensive upfront compared to manual pool cleaning tools. Additionally, the lack of availability of specialized retailers or distributors that offer a wide range of robotic pool cleaner options in Turkmenistan could hinder market growth. Furthermore, factors such as maintenance requirements, technical support, and after-sales service could pose challenges for consumers considering investing in robotic pool cleaners. Overall, addressing these challenges through targeted marketing strategies, pricing adjustments, and improving distribution channels could help unlock the full potential of the robotic pool cleaner market in Turkmenistan.
